IOLG BOSS FLAGS OFF THE COVID-19 VACCINATION EXERCISE AT OKE AJE MARKET

By AJetukesi Abosede

The Executive Chairman, Ijebu-Ode Local government, Hon Babatunde Emilola Gazal has again displayed his unflinching commitment to the welfare of the indigene of the Council Area, by flagging off the COVID-19 VACCINATION exercise amongst the Market traders at Oke Aje Market on Monday, January 24, 2022.

In his Welcome speech, the Chairman expressed his gratitude to Governor Dapo Abiodun, for being prompt and responsive to the yearnings and feelings of the people especially the indigene and resident of ijebu-ode.

Hon. Gazal also appreciated the Baba oloja and Iya oloja of Oke-Aje Market, for encouraging the market men and women to come out in their large numbers to be vaccinated.

He  also commended their efforts towards their cooperation with the medical staff of the local government and urged them to make sure they visit any health centre close to them for their next vaccine.

He however, promised to always give them  necessary support, anytime they called on him.

The event was attended by;  Director of Medical and Health Department, Dr Fayomi;  Leader of the house, Hon (Ogbeni) Adeshola Saula Ogundare and Head of information, Education and Sports Department, Mrs OsunderuTaiwo
